Henry Wellcome Building for Biomolecular NMR Spectroscopy
Henry Wellcome Building for Biomolecular NMR Spectroscopy is an university building in Birmingham, England. Henry Wellcome Building for Biomolecular NMR Spectroscopy is situated nearby to University of Birmingham Pritchatts Park Village, as well as near Barnes Library.Places of Interest Nearby

Bournbrook is an industrial and residential district in southwest Birmingham, England, in the ward of Bournbrook and Selly Park and the parliamentary constituency of Birmingham Selly Oak.

Chad Valley is a small area of Birmingham, England, located between Harborne and Edgbaston. It contains a fish pond and the Chad Vale Primary School. It takes its name from the Chad Brook, a tributary of the River Rea and in turn gave it to the Chad Valley toy company.
